Strategic Insights Reveal New Pathways for Antiscalants Scale Inhibitors Market
The scope of the Antiscalants Scale Inhibitors Market appears increasingly promising, with a market size projected to escalate from 4.206 USD in 2024 to 6.22 USD by 2035. This anticipated growth, calculated at a CAGR of 3.62%, signals a robust demand for scale inhibitors in water treatment and oil extraction applications. Key industry participants such as Dow (US), BASF (DE), and Solvay (BE) are essential in this evolving landscape, as they contribute significantly to the innovation of antiscalant technologies. These companies are not only leaders in production but also invest heavily in research and development, aiming to meet the stringent regulatory requirements faced in various regions. Meanwhile, firms like Ecolab (US) and SABIC (SA) are instrumental in expanding the market's application across diverse industries, ensuring that antiscalants remain integral to operational efficiencies in both water treatment and oil extraction sectors.

In examining regional dynamics, North America holds a commanding presence in the Antiscalants Scale Inhibitors Market due to rigorous industrial practices and regulatory frameworks. However, the Asia-Pacific region is rapidly emerging, marked by swift industrialization and significant investments in water treatment infrastructure, indicating a shift in the competitive landscape. According to market research, the demand for antiscalants in the oil and gas sector specifically contributes approximately 45% of the total market share, driven by the increasing need for efficient water management and enhanced production processes. For instance, in the United States alone, the oil production rate has surged by 25% in the past decade, prompting a corresponding rise in the usage of antiscalants to optimize extraction processes. Furthermore, the global shift towards renewable energy sources is pushing companies to adopt more sustainable practices, with a projected 20% increase in the use of biodegradable antiscalants by 2030. Real-world implementations, such as the deployment of advanced polymeric antiscalants in shale gas extraction, demonstrate the effectiveness of these innovations in reducing operational costs and improving yield.
